That college is Marathwada Mitra Mandal’s College of Architecture (MMCOA) in Pune. Established in 1985, MMCOA wasn’t just another architecture college—it was the first private, unaided institution of its kind in Maharashtra. And it still stands out. Let’s unpack why.

A Brief Look Back: Breaking Ground in 1985

Think of the mid-80s in Maharashtra. Architecture education was mostly in government-run institutions. So stepping forward as the very first unaided private architecture college in the state was a bold move. It meant building a curriculum, studios, faculty, and reputation from scratch.

MMCOA did exactly that—and not just built it, but shaped it with purpose. Since its inception in 1985, the college has grown into one of the most prestigious private architecture schools in Maharashtra, setting a standard that others would try to match.

Affiliation and Recognition You Can Trust

MMCOA isn’t just a legacy name. It’s officially affiliated to Savitribai Phule Pune University, recognized by the Council of Architecture, and approved by AICTE.

You're stepping into a college that checks all the boxes—academic rigor, regulatory legitimacy, and career credibility.

A Curriculum That Marries Theory with Practice

Look beyond the label "architecture college." MMCOA offers multiple programs:

Bachelor of Architecture (B.Arch) – five years of deep, accredited training.

Diploma in Architecture, Diploma in Interior Design – great for those who want hands-on design skills.

Master of Architecture (Design & Project Management) – a powerful two-year postgraduate degree.

Facilities That Feel Like an Architect’s Studio, Not a School

This isn’t your average classroom setup. MMCOA’s 4-acre campus in central Pune hosts:

Spacious, well-lit design studios and lecture rooms

ICT-enabled seminar halls and a polished auditorium for discussions and critiques

A library with over 6,000 books, e-journals, rare manuscripts

Specialized labs and workshops—survey, carpentry, model-making, climate analysis, and more

A material museum to touch, feel, and learn from real samples

Plus amenities you might not expect but appreciate—gym, yoga room, eatery, EV charging, and secure spaces
